Manchester City produced a scintillating second-half performance to storm past Chelsea and capitalise on Arsenal's shock defeat to Bournemouth, reducing the gap at the top of the Premier League table to six points.

There was no breakthrough before the interval with the net only bulging for Marc Cucurella's disallowed 16th-minute strike, but City came out swinging after the restart and found an opener via the head of in-form Nico O'Reilly, converting Rayan Cherki's cross.

Cherki was then once again provider for City's second, punching a delectable ball through to Marc Guehi who produced a striker's touch and finish to double his side's lead, putting the visitors in complete control.

Jeremy Doku put the game to bed with just over 20 minutes to play, slotting past Robert Sanchez after Moises Caicedo was mugged of the ball, securing a win that puts City in a confident position ahead of next weekend's title six-pointer with the Gunners.
